As our new Software Integration Developer, you will develop and maintain backend applications, APIs, and integration services that support critical processes across Abacus Medicine Group.
Working with Microsoft Azure and the .NET ecosystem, you will design solutions that enable reliable communication between systems and applications. You will also contribute to technical design discussions and architectural decisions, combining hands-on development with a broader view of our system landscape.
Developing and maintaining backend applications, APIs, and integration services
Designing secure, scalable, and maintainable solutions aligned with our platform architecture and integration standards
Building and supporting APIs that enable reliable communication between systems and business applications
Developing reusable backend services and integration components
Working with databases and cloud-native services to ensure performance, reliability, and data integrity
Participating in technical design discussions, code reviews, and architecture decisions
Collaborating with developers, Product Owners, and business stakeholders to translate requirements into technical solutions
Monitoring, troubleshooting, and continuously improving business-critical applications and integrations
Contributing to development standards, shared technical assets, and best practices
Supporting knowledge sharing and mentoring less experienced colleagues
Backend: .NET, C#, SQL, and Cosmos DB
Integration: REST APIs, SOAP, Azure Service Bus, API Management, and Logic Apps
Cloud: Microsoft Azure, including App Services and Function Apps
Security: OAuth2 and JWT
DevOps: Azure DevOps CI/CD and ARM Templates/Bicep
Methodology: Agile
